Anyone ever build an outdoor keezer?

Any issues or advice?

Can you please post links to your build or post it?
 
Mine is in an attached garage in Texas. So not quite as hot as an outdoor, but close. First one lasted about 8 years. Second one is in its second year. Will it be under cover?
 
I plan to put the freezer in a shed like structure that backs up to an outdoor kitchen and have a 12" long tunnel from the collar to my taps. The shed roof will flip up to access the freezer. At some point I plan to put a roof over my taps and outdoor kitchen, but that may be later. I am in Texas as well. I hope this helps with your responses. Any issues or advice with my plan.

Does the heat and dirt typically kill freezers?
 
Yes, mine sits outdoors on our deck. The deck is covered. Link to the build thread is in my sig.
 
As far as the dirt goes, the rear/bottom of the chest freezer is typically open. Lots of crud will collect in there. An occasional cleaning with a shop vac would probably help keep the dirt and spider webs at bay. As for the heat, the freezer is going to have to work harder in an uninsulated structure during the summer months. But you will be able to get several years out of it in my experience.
